Water School was a guitar pop and guitar rock band from Baltimore. We were born in 2004 and died in the winter of 2008.
Our first album, Break Up With Water School, was released in UK and Europe, courtesy of our good friends at Neon Tetra Records.
Our second album, "Animals And Their Hiding Places", is an enchanting affair of keyboardy harmonious tunes and is now available for purchase on the iTunes. It was written and recorded entirely during the month of February (2007).
